3759 I Pill - white three-sided

Pill with imprint 3759 I is White, Three-sided and has been identified as Lisinopril 10 mg. It is supplied by Teva Pharmaceuticals USA.

Lisinopril is used in the treatment of Heart Attack; High Blood Pressure; Heart Failure and belongs to the drug class Angiotensin Converting Enzyme Inhibitors. There is positive evidence of human fetal risk during pregnancy. Lisinopril 10 mg is not a controlled substance under the Controlled Substances Act (CSA).
